Slik endrer du skrift i Access VBA

Microsoft Access er programmeringsspråk, Visual Basic for Applications (VBA), gir tilgang 2010 brukere å endre noen aspekter av Access utseende. Dette inkluderer muligheten til å endre skriftnavn og andre egenskaper for alle tabeller og rapporter. Ett skritt involvert i å endre en skrift med Access VBA er å identifisere de skriftmessige egenskaper VBA objektmodell. Ved å bruke VBA til å endre en skrift i Access, kan du gi dine rapporter og annen tilgangselementer et særegent utseende med tekst som er lett å lese.

Bruksanvisning

1 Åpen tilgang. Klikk på "Table" -ikonet på "Create" -kategorien.

2 Skriv inn noen tegn i cellen til høyre for "ID" -feltet. Tegnene du skriver vil vises i Access standard font, Calibri. VBA-programmet du vil legge inn neste vil endre det skrift.

3 Trykk "Alt" og "F11" samtidig for å gå inn i VBA integrert utviklingsmiljø, som er bedre kjent som IDE.

4 Klikk på "Insert" -menyen overskriften, og klikk deretter på "Module" element. Dette gjør et nytt vindu for å skrive inn VBA programerklæringer.

5 Lim inn følgende kode i kodevinduet:

Public Sub setDefaultFont ()

SetOption "default font name", "arial"

SetOption "font size default", "16"

End Sub

6 Kjør dette programmet ved å klikke på en av sine uttalelser og trykke "F5".

7 Return to Tilgang ved å trykke "Alt" og "F11" samtidig igjen. Opprett et nytt bord ved å følge trinn 1 og 2. Denne gangen vil tegnene du skriver være i skriften som er angitt i VBA program - Arial, størrelse 16 poeng.

8 Klikk på en eksisterende tabell i navigasjonsruten på skjermen til venstre, og klikk deretter på "Create" -menyen overskriften.

9 Klikk på "Report" -ikonet på verktøylinjen for å lage en ny rapport basert på bordet du valgte i trinn 8. Du bruker en annen VBA program for å endre en skrift i rapporten.

10 Klikk på et tomt område på "Detail" i den nye rapporten, og klikk deretter på "Egenskaper".

11 Klikk på "Down" pilen i "På Format" tilfelle "Properties" -panelet på skjermen til høyre. Klikk "Event prosedyre", som forteller tilgang til å opprette en ny kode modul for å holde VBA-programmet. Klikk på knappen ved siden av pil ned til å angi den modulen.

12 Lim inn følgende uttalelser inne i "Detail_Format" subrutine som Tilgang bringer deg til. Disse uttalelsene sett skriften navnet på en rapport kontroll som kalles "Felt1" til "Courier" og endre skrift størrelse til 18 poeng.

Field1.FontName = "Courier"

Field1.FontSize = 18

1. 3 Skriv over "Felt1" tekst med navnet på en kontroll som vises i rapporten. Du kan finne et feltnavn ved å se på toppen av en kolonne av tabellen du valgte i trinn 8 for å lage en rapport fra. For eksempel, for en tabell av selgere, en av kolonnenavnene kan være "Fornavn", og andre kan være "Etternavn" eller "AvgSalesPerMonth."

14 Trykk "Alt" og "F11" samtidig for å gå tilbake til Access, og deretter kjøre VBA-kode ved å høyreklikke på rapportens fanen og klikke "Rapporter utsikt." Rapporten vil vises og vise "Courier" font i feltet du angitt i trinn 12.